  <dc:title>Copy letter from Robert William Frederick Harrison, to Professor [Herbert] McLeod, Fellow of the Royal Society</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Sends the List of Serials. Harrison asks McLeod to forward a draft of the memorandum he wishes to send with it to members of the Committee so he can have it multiplied and sent round with the proofs. 

Hopes McLeod is feeling the benefit of the change of air, as it is very hot [in London] today.</dc:description>
  <dc:date>17 July 1901</dc:date>
